Mountains of Fukui Prefecture

Fukui Prefecture is home to 116 named mountains. The highest is Mt. Ninomine at 1,978 m.

At a glance

There are 116 named mountains in Fukui Prefecture. Mt. Ninomine is the highest point. The most prominent mountain is Mt. Nogo-Hakusan.
